Negros Power opens doors to new, more accessible office in Bacolod

The new location of Negros Power at The Row in Barangay Bata, Bacolod City.*

Negros Power has officially started operations at its new, permanent office at The Row in Barangay Bata, Bacolod City.

This move marks a significant step for the company, providing greater accessibility and convenience for consumers, especially those residing in Bacolod, Jonathan Cabrera, the firm’s spokesman, said Monday, March 3.

After operating from Robinsons East in Barangay Villamonte for over six months, Negros Power has relocated to a strategically chosen location on Lacson Street, Barangay Bata.

The new office is designed to accommodate the growing needs of customers and ensure faster, more efficient service, Cabrera said.

“As of today, the new office is fully operational and ready to cater to various customer concerns, including billing inquiries, service applications, payments, and other electricity-related transactions,” he said.

“Our dedicated team is committed to delivering high-quality service and ensuring a seamless experience for all our consumers”, he added.

The new office houses all departments and employees of Negros Power, including the offices of its top officials, Customer Care, Network Development and Operations Group, Corporate Energy Sourcing and Regulatory Affairs, Control Center, and 24/7 Helpline among others.

The office is open from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. Monday to Saturday, with no noon break, Cabrera said.*
